In a stepparent fostering, the procedure can be easier if the various other biological parent approvals and voluntarily relinquishes their adult rights. Nevertheless, if the non-custodial parent contests the adoption, can not lie, or is regarded unfit, an attorney is essential. A legal representative will certainly browse the procedures required to unwillingly terminate that moms and dad's civil liberties, which often entails showing desertion or neglect to the court. The legal representative works as the adoptive moms and dads' supporter, representing their rate of interests. A need for every single fostering is the home research, a complete examination of the possible adoptive moms and dads and their home. An assessor, usually a certified social employee, carries out interviews, performs a home safety and security evaluation, and produces a detailed record for the court. The home research confirms that the petitioners can offer a risk-free, stable setting for the youngster. This is a procedure that can take many years as the system will focus on reunification with the kid's family members prior to making them adoptable. If parental rights have not been willingly relinquished, separate paperwork to request the TPR has to be submitted. This requires offering the court with lawfully adequate grounds for ending the parents' civil liberties. If a moms and dad has actually died, a certified fatality certificate is submitted rather than a consent. These types can be obtained from the neighborhood region court clerk's workplace or the state's judicial website.
